Alejandro Ciordia Morandeira

Alejandro Ciordia is a PhD candidate in Sociology and Social Research at the University of Trento. He obtained a BA in Law and Political Science and a MA in Contemporary Arab and Islamic Studies, both at Universidad Autónoma de Madrid (UAM), and has been a visiting researcher at the University of the Basque Country (UPV/EHU). His research interests are on social movements and collective action, civil society organizations, social capital, nationalist movements, repertoires of contention, and political violence. Methodologically he favours multi-method approaches, combining tools such as social network analysis and several forms of text analyses. His doctoral dissertation focuses on the recent evolution of interorganizational networks within the Basque environmental field before and after the end of violent conflict.
